Understanding Your Skin Type

Before embarking on any skincare routine, it is essential to understand your skin type. According to Dr. Leslie Baumann, a renowned dermatologist, there are four basic skin types: oily, dry, combination, and sensitive. Each skin type has unique needs and responds differently to various skincare products and routines. For instance, oily skin may require products that control excess oil production, while dry skin may benefit from hydrating and moisturizing products.

The Fundamental Steps: Cleansing, Toning, and Moisturizing

Regardless of your skin type, three steps are fundamental to any skincare routine: cleansing, toning, and moisturizing. Cleansing removes dirt, oil, and makeup from your skin. Toning balances your skin’s pH levels and prepares it for the next step: moisturizing. Moisturizing hydrates your skin and locks in moisture, preventing dryness and flaking. These steps should be done in the mentioned order for maximum effectiveness.

Enhancing Your Routine: Exfoliation, Serums, and Eye Creams

While cleansing, toning, and moisturizing are essential, other steps can enhance the effectiveness of your routine. Exfoliation, for instance, removes dead skin cells, promoting skin renewal and enhancing the absorption of other skincare products. Serums, packed with active ingredients, target specific skin concerns like aging, pigmentation, and acne. Eye creams, on the other hand, are designed to address issues specific to the delicate skin around the eyes, such as dark circles and puffiness.

FAQ Section

1. How often should I exfoliate my skin?

Exfoliation should be done 1-2 times a week. Over-exfoliation can lead to skin irritation and damage.

2. Can I use my daytime skincare products at night?

While some products can be used both day and night, others, like sunscreen, are unnecessary at night. Nighttime is also the best time to use products with active ingredients like retinol, which can be degraded by sunlight.

3. How long should I wait between applying different skincare products?

It’s best to wait for about a minute between applying different products. This allows each product to be absorbed into the skin before the next one is applied.

4. Is it necessary to use a separate eye cream?

Yes, the skin around the eyes is thinner and more delicate than the rest of the face. Eye creams are formulated to be gentler and to address specific eye-area issues.

5. Can I skip my nighttime skincare routine if I’m too tired?

Skipping your routine occasionally won’t cause significant harm, but regular neglect can lead to skin issues over time.
